Lmn Tonc brings the taste of fresh lemon soda straight into your bowl. This tobacco combines zesty lemon with pleasant sweetness and the slightly bitter note of tonic water. The result: a perfectly balanced lemonade flavor that isn’t too sweet, but refreshes with a fine bitter touch – almost like a cool summer drink.
As with all Must H blends, this tobacco is produced in Russia using intense Burley tobacco with a generous amount of molasses. This ensures thick clouds and long-lasting flavor. The standout feature here is the balance of sweetness, acidity, and bitterness – never overpowering. Lmn Tonc is ideal for anyone who enjoys citrusy, slightly bitter, and truly refreshing blends. About Must H
If someone asks us which is the most popular hookah tobacco brand in our shop, the answer has to be Must H hookah tobacco.
Must H is a real heavyweight in the German hookah scene. Many Burley lovers swear by the Darkblend from Russia, and quite a few community members would describe the strong and intensely flavored Russian tobacco as the ultimate choice.
Since there were issues with the original importer, another one has taken over supplying the German market. To make this change clear, the brand name was changed from Musthave to Must H, and the flavor names were slightly adjusted. However, these changes in name have absolutely nothing to do with the tobacco itself, as it still comes directly from the manufacturer in Russia. In the meantime, more and more varieties from the producer are also arriving in Germany – sometimes as limited drops, sometimes to stay. In any case, we try to carry all the latest varieties.
